Activities - how the charity spends its money

Non profit charity dedicated to rescuing and rehoming Sled dogs around the UK. We operate using foster homes country wide helping Sled dogs find their happily ever after.

Income and expenditure

Data for financial year ending 31 March 2024

Total income: £239,394
Total expenditure: £139,646
